The present study was conducted to develop a model of the role of spiritual health in the quality of work life and psychological adjustment of injured professional athletes. The method of this research was applied and descriptive-correlation in terms of purpose and data collection, respectively. The statistical population of the study included all the professional athletes referred to Golestan Medical School in 2019. The mean age of the participants was equal to 25.8 ± 2.8 years old.  Data collection was done using a questionnaire. The questionnaire used in this study had 68 questions measuring three variables including mental health (12 questions), psychological adjustment (29 questions), and quality of working life (27 questions). The results of the study showed that, spiritual health has a significant effect on the psychological adjustment and quality of work life of professional injured athletes. Therefore, it is suggested to help the professional athletes in developing their self-knowledge and abilities, while improving the spiritual health, as well as enhancing the psychological adjustment and quality of work life.
